    blood pressure question

    my blood pressure has been running on the average 137/68 and my resting pulse has been between 58-63. The doctors say im fine but my question is what can I do to help bring down that top number without meds ? I have read that it could be stress related or genetics.

    Anyone have the similiar problem or ideas how to fix this ?

    Im currently on TRT and have not blasted in almost 2 months now

    How is your cardio? You may wan to add more. Honestly I dont think it's bad and everyone is different. You may also try less salt and look up other foods that raise the BP. Just being on TRT also can raise your BP so it may be normal.
